C#与XHTML/CSS/JavaScript代码风格指南:命名与后缀规则详解
需积分: 10 136 浏览量
更新于2024-08-10
收藏 741KB PDF 举报
项目代码风格指南V1.0.20130605概述了C#、XHTML和CSS编程语言的统一编码规范。这份文档强调了清晰、一致性及可读性的原则,以提升代码质量。
1. **C#代码风格要求**
- **命名约定**:
- 类、结构、委托、接口、字段、属性和方法采用Pascal风格命名(首字母大写),如`ProductList`。
- 局部变量和方法参数采用Camel风格(首字母小写,单词分隔大写),如`productUnitPrice`。
- 避免缩写,确保可理解性。
- **缩进与结构**:
- 使用Tab键,缩进4个空格,保持代码整洁。
- 源文件内最多定义两个类型,类型名称与文件名一致。
- 注释规范,对复杂逻辑进行解释。
- **控制结构**:
- 简单的`if`语句允许省略花括号,但仍需遵循在同一行原则。
- 使用`this`调用类型内部成员,`base`调用父类成员。
2. **XHTML代码风格要求**
- **结构和封闭性**:
- 标记层次结构对应代码结构,确保完整闭合。
- 长代码段在末尾添加标识符,便于阅读。
- **注释**:
- 用于解释代码块的功能和目的。
3. **CSS代码风格要求**
- **缩进与注释**:
- 半展开代码结构,使用Tab缩进4个空格。
- 提供必要的代码注释。
- **代码比例**:
- 控制嵌入式样式、内联样式和外联样式表的比例,保持平衡。
4. **JavaScript代码风格要求**
- 与C#类似,强调半展开代码结构、Tab缩进和注释,注重代码清晰度。
1.18和1.19部分介绍了**集合类型后缀命名**和**常见后缀命名**规则,比如数组使用`Array`后缀,费用相关变量命名为`Cost`,日期相关变量为`Date`,这些规则有助于提高代码的可读性和维护性。
这份指南为开发者提供了一套明确的编码规范,确保代码的一致性和可维护性,对于团队协作以及长期项目开发具有重要意义。遵循这些原则能帮助提升代码的专业度和质量,使得项目更具可扩展性和易读性。
2021-09-18 上传
2009-03-18 上传
2018-11-06 上传
155 浏览量
小白便当
- 粉丝: 0
- 资源: 3902
最新资源
- 3G无线知识入门 4
- 3G无线知识入门 3
- 网上营业厅积分支付接口文档 电信积分接口说明
- 3G无线知识入门 1
- ejb3.0入门经典教程
- php5.ini.doc
- Pro WPF in C Sharp 2008
- ea7 入门教程.0
- Eclipse整合開發環境.pdf
- HP ProLiant DL160 G6服务器
- 中国电信集团公司技术标准_短信息网关协议(SMGP)规范(V3.1).pdf
- SCP1-040156draft.doc
- FTP命令详解及使用技巧.doc
- c语言嵌入式系统编程修炼之道
- Android Anatomy and Physiology.pdf
- HP ProLiant BL490 G6刀片服务器